Abstract

The invention relates to the technical field of cable identification, and discloses a power cable identification and spatial positioning method and system, and the method comprises the following steps: S1, detecting a target cable, completing the identification of the cable in an environment, and obtaining the point cloud data of the cable; s2, processing the point cloud data through a visual processing program, and performing fitting reconstruction and pose calculation in combination with cable identification data; and S3, the visual processing module sends a final processing result to the terminal. According to the invention, three types of sensors are used in cooperation and complement each other in advantages, and an optimization algorithm is carried in an equipment chip, so that the equipment can realize accurate positioning of the cable even in unfavorable working environments such as strong light, backlight and complex space environment.

technical field [0001] The invention relates to the technical field of cable identification, in particular to a power cable identification and spatial positioning method and system. Background technique [0002] At present, there are two main methods of cable identification and positioning during live work such as disconnection of leads: manual identification and positioning and single sensor identification and positioning. In manual identification and positioning, the staff locates the pose of the cable according to the remotely transmitted video images and then performs subsequent operations; the latter uses sensors to scan the on-site environment and inputs the scanned images into algorithms for processing to achieve positioning.
